Does Amway still own Peter Island?

Peter Island is the largest private island in the BVI and the fifth largest of the 60 islands, quays, and exposed reefs that comprise the BVI. It was owned by the Amway Corporation from 1978 until 2001 when full ownership was transferred to the Van Andel family, co-owners of Amway….Peter Island.

What happened Peter Island?

Closure. After facing extensive damage from hurricanes Irma and Maria in 2017, the resort closed and laid off 176 employees. Only 35 remained. Until now, the resort had not announced a timeline for reopening beyond stating that it would remain closed for the duration of 2017 and into late 2018.

What is the best time to go to the British Virgin Islands?

The best time to visit the British Virgin Islands is from September to November, before the crushing crowds of the winter holidays. Though the fall months see the highest amount of precipitation, they also welcome some of the lowest hotel rates you’ll find all year.

Is BVI safe?

Crime. Levels of crime in the British Virgin Islands are relatively low, although serious incidents do occur including armed robbery and drug-related gun crime.

Is Peter Island going to reopen?

Peter Island to reopen by December 2021 After a long silence following Hurricane Irma, Peter Island Resort and Spa has announced that it aims to reopen the “main sections” of its 52 hotel rooms and three villas by December 2021, government announced this week.

Who owns Peter Island in BVI?

Amway Corp. owned the island during my seven-year stint managing the resort on property and at corporate offices in Grand Rapids. In 2000, Amway sold the island to (Jay) Van Andel Enterprises, which still owns the island under the guidance of Dave Van Andel and his team at VAE.

Are there mosquitoes in the British Virgin Islands?

Natasha Frett said Chikungunya, ZIKA and Dengue Fever are diseases contracted through the bite of an Ades aegypti mosquito and that these mosquitoes are endemic to the British Virgin Islands.

Can you drink the water in the British Virgin Islands?

You can drink the water in the BVI, it’s all government water for the most part, some places use wells or rain water however, wherever you stay just ask where they get theirs from. Otherwise if you don’t enjoy the taste just buy bottled water like some.
